CVE-2021-34823Network attack vector

Unauthenticated file disclosure via external XML entities

Published Aug 13, 2021 · Updated Aug 4, 2024

XXE in ON24 ScreenShare before 2.0 for macOS allows remote attackers to read local files through its built-in HTTP server. The server downloads attacker-specified configuration XML over HTTP, and its parser resolves external entities against the local file system before uploading the resulting content. No authentication or user interaction is required, and exposure is limited to files accessible to the logged-on macOS user.
